Start your journey by selecting a beginner-friendly drone kit that fits your skill level and budget. Research the wide range of available options, each with its own unique features and capabilities.
- Consider factors such as flight time, camera quality, and distance when making your selection.
- Once you've your kit, gather the necessary tools such as screwdrivers, pliers, and a soldering iron (if required).
- Organize a clean and well-lit workspace to ensure a smooth assembly process.
